About Stonebridge
The surname Stonebridge is of English origin and is derived from a combination of the words "stone" and "bridge." It is a locational surname, indicating that the original bearer of the name lived near or was associated with a stone bridge. The name may have been given to individuals who resided near a prominent stone bridge or worked as bridge builders or masons. Overall, the surname Stonebridge signifies a connection to a specific geographical feature, highlighting the importance of bridges and stonework in the ancestral history of the bearers of this name.
